Wanda Cook Obituary

Wanda Lee Cook passed away on August 4, 2014 in Deer Park, Texas. Wanda was born on October 15, 1939 in Allegan, Michigan to Marshall and Margaret Clark. Wanda was a long time employee of the Deer Park School District where she worked as a school bus monitor for children with special needs. Preceeded in death by her loving husband Thomas E. Cook. Wanda is survived by her daughter Sharon Jenkins and husband Danel of Deer Park; sister Pamela Brown and husband Michael of Allegan, Michigan. Grandchildren Tyler, Hunter and Brody Jenkins. A graveside service was held on Thursday August, 7th, 2014 at Forest Park East Cemetery in Webster, Texas where she was quietly laid to rest.
